Research on co-combustion characteristics and kinetics of sewage sludge and rice husk

According to the characteristics of high moisture content and low calorific value of sludge, an innovative co-combustion method of sewage sludge and rice husk was proposed. The method provided a theoretical basis for the resource utilization of sewage sludge. Through thermal analysis technology, the changes of thermogravimetric and derivative thermogravimetric at different temperatures with various ratios of mixed combustion materials were investigated. Then, the corresponding dynamic model was established to analyze the dynamic mechanism of the co-combustion material. The following conclusions were obtained: First, the combustion of mixed fuel when the amount of sludge is less than 30% is beneficial. Therefore, the use of sewage sludge as fuel to combustion is possible. Moreover, the kinetic mechanism of the combustion reaction can be divided into four processes, that is, one-dimensional diffusion, chemical reaction, one-dimensional diffusion, and three-dimensional diffusion.
